Why Regular Dental Visits Matter
Regular dental visits go beyond routine. They play a crucial role in detecting conditions early. Your dentist checks for cavities and gum disease, which can lead to more serious health issues like heart disease and diabetes.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, untreated cavities are common in both children and adults, leading to pain and infections. Early detection through regular check-ups prevents such issues from escalating.
The Connection Between Oral and Overall Health
Oral health shows signs of other health concerns. Conditions like oral cancer and infections can affect your general health. Regular exams include screenings for oral cancer, ensuring any problems are caught and treated early. Gum disease is linked to other health issues, including heart disease and stroke. Managing your oral health reduces these risks, keeping your body healthier overall.

Comparison of Common Dental Conditions and Potential Health Impacts
Dental Condition | Potential Health Impact |
Cavities | Pain, infections, and abscesses |
Gum Disease | Increased risk of heart disease and stroke |
Oral Cancer | Potential spread to other body parts |
Tooth Loss | Difficulty chewing and speaking |
